    I bought the Lutron smart switches but couldn’t use them. They require a neutral wire in the switch box. Most switch boxes have a two wire, power down, power up and a copper ground wire. You CANNOT use the power ground wire as your neutral. Building codes are changing to now run a three wire into the switch box to provide the neutral. If you are building keep that in mind.
